Where did ancient greek go to find out messages from the gods in oepidus?
Step2247 [10]
Ancient Greeks would go to an oracle to find out different prophecies. Oracles were said to be able to see the future and were granted prophecies from the gods themselves. Greeks would go to the oracle to try and find out their future or answers to why things were going poorly.

Which statement best describes the relationship between the narrative style and the genre of "The Tell-Tale Heart"?
german

Answer:

Using an unreliable and excitable narrator allows Poe to explore irrationality and strong emotions.

Explanation:

The protagonist of <em>The Tell-Tale Heart </em>is a lunatic, a crazy man who is irritated by the old man in whose house he lives in to the point where he decides to kill him. During the story, we see the protagonist's erratic thoughts, maniacal ideas, and ultimately, his impromptu decision to murder the old man because of his 'devil eye.'

The narrator is unreliable, meaning that we cannot trust him because of his jumbled thoughts and powerful emotions.
